The Yellow Humor Grand Prix in Casarrubios del Monte offers a thrilling outdoor adventure combining physical and skill-based challenges with a festive dinner, live entertainment, and a vibrant nightclub experience. Designed for groups of six or more, this year-round event delivers fun, laughter, and unforgettable memories in the scenic highlands of Toledo. Participants enjoy teamwork, friendly competition, and a full evening of entertainment. The event fosters connections, energy, and joy in a beautiful natural setting. Expert Recommendations

Wear comfortable, breathable clothing and proper sports shoes suitable for outdoor physical activity. Bring a change of clothes and sunscreen for sun protection. The event is suitable year-round, but advance booking is strongly recommended for larger groups. The experience includes moderate to intense physical challenges, so assess your personal fitness level before booking to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.

About the Area

The event takes place at a multi-adventure outdoor venue located at Calle Cuenca 1000, Casarrubios del Monte, Toledo. The site features dedicated facilities for group activities, dinners, and live performances. Nearby attractions include traditional restaurants, hiking trails, and cultural landmarks in both Casarrubios and Toledo, all easily reachable by private car or local public transport.
